Пользовательские дополнения
На главную
proceduralDungeonLib.GetScenarioInfo( scenarioId )
Возвращает информацию о сценарии.
-- библиотека:
proceduralDungeonLib
-- объявление:
function GetScenarioInfo( scenarioId )
-- параметры:
scenarioId: ObjectId - идентификатор сценария
-- возвращаемое значение
table or nil - таблица с полями:
scenarioId: ObjectId - идентификатор сценария
state: Number(ENUM_EventGoalState) - текущее состояние сценария
name: WString - название сценария
description: WString - описание сценария
goals: table[1,..] of ObjectId - список идентификаторов заданий относящихся к данному сценарию
-- пример:
local scenarioInfo = proceduralDungeonLib.GetScenarioInfo( scenarioId )
Доп. ссылки:
Search: "CategoryLuaApi" "CategoryProceduralDungeonLib"
EnumEventGoalState
EnumEventGoalType
EventAvatarEnterProceduralDungeon
EventAvatarLeaveProceduralDungeon
EventProceduralDungeonGoalAdded
EventProceduralDungeonGoalCountChanged
EventProceduralDungeonGoalsChanged
EventProceduralDungeonGoalStateChanged
EventProceduralDungeonPointsChanged
EventProceduralDungeonScenarioAdded
EventProceduralDungeonScenarioStateChanged
FunctionProceduralDungeonLibGetEscapeSpell
FunctionProceduralDungeonLibGetGoalInfo
FunctionProceduralDungeonLibGetGoals
FunctionProceduralDungeonLibGetPoints
FunctionProceduralDungeonLibGetRunScenarioSpell
FunctionProceduralDungeonLibGetScenarioInfo
FunctionProceduralDungeonLibGetScenarios
FunctionProceduralDungeonLibGetStopScenarioSpell
FunctionProceduralDungeonLibIsExist
CategoryLuaApi
CategoryFunction
CategoryProceduralDungeonLib
На главную